SMAJ60CA-E3/61 Information
SMAJ60CA-E3/61 by Vishay Semiconductors is a Transient Suppressor.
Transient Suppressors are under the broader part category of Diodes.
A diode is a electrical part that can control the direction in which the current flows in a device. Consider factors like voltage drop, current capacity, reverse voltage, and operating frequency when selecting a diode. Read more about Diodes on our Diodes part category page.

DIODE 300 W, BIDIRECTIONAL, SILICON, TVS DIODE, DO-214AC, ROHS COMPLIANT, PLASTIC, SMA, 2 PIN, Transient Suppressor
|
Pbfree Code | Yes | |
Rohs Code | Yes | |
Part Life Cycle Code | Active | |
Ihs Manufacturer | VISHAY SEMICONDUCTORS | |
Part Package Code | DO-214AC | |
Package Description | R-PDSO-C2 | |
Pin Count | 2 | |
Reach Compliance Code | unknown | |
ECCN Code | EAR99 | |
HTS Code | 8541.10.00.50 | |
Additional Feature | EXCELLENT CLAMPING CAPABILITY | |
Breakdown Voltage-Max | 73.7 V | |
Breakdown Voltage-Min | 66.7 V | |
Breakdown Voltage-Nom | 70.2 V | |
Clamping Voltage-Max | 96.8 V | |
Configuration | SINGLE | |
Diode Element Material | SILICON | |
Diode Type | TRANS VOLTAGE SUPPRESSOR DIODE | |
JEDEC-95 Code | DO-214AC | |
JESD-30 Code | R-PDSO-C2 | |
JESD-609 Code | e3 | |
Moisture Sensitivity Level | 1 | |
Non-rep Peak Rev Power Dis-Max | 400 W | |
Number of Elements | 1 | |
Number of Terminals | 2 | |
Operating Temperature-Max | 150 °C | |
Operating Temperature-Min | -55 °C | |
Package Body Material | PLASTIC/EPOXY | |
Package Shape | RECTANGULAR | |
Package Style | SMALL OUTLINE | |
Peak Reflow Temperature (Cel) | 260 | |
Polarity | BIDIRECTIONAL | |
Power Dissipation-Max | 3.3 W | |
Qualification Status | Not Qualified | |
Reference Standard | UL RECOGNIZED | |
Rep Pk Reverse Voltage-Max | 60 V | |
Reverse Current-Max | 1 µA | |
Reverse Test Voltage | 60 V | |
Surface Mount | YES | |
Technology | AVALANCHE | |
Terminal Finish | MATTE TIN | |
Terminal Form | C BEND | |
Terminal Position | DUAL | |
Time@Peak Reflow Temperature-Max (s) | 30 |

SMAJ60CA-E3/61 Frequently Asked Questions (FAQ)
-
The recommended footprint and land pattern for SMAJ60CA-E3/61 can be found in the Vishay Intertechnologies' application note AN10343, which provides guidelines for surface mount assembly of SMAJ devices.
-
Thermal considerations for SMAJ60CA-E3/61 include ensuring good thermal conductivity between the device and the PCB, using thermal vias, and providing adequate heat sinking. Refer to the Vishay Intertechnologies' application note AN10343 for more information.
-
The maximum allowable voltage for SMAJ60CA-E3/61 is 60V, as specified in the datasheet. Exceeding this voltage may result in device failure or reduced reliability.
-
SMAJ60CA-E3/61 is rated for operation up to 150°C. However, the device's performance and reliability may degrade at high temperatures. Consult the datasheet and application notes for guidance on using the device in high-temperature environments.
-
To ensure the reliability of SMAJ60CA-E3/61 in a high-reliability application, follow the recommended assembly and handling procedures, use a robust PCB design, and perform thorough testing and validation. Consult the Vishay Intertechnologies' application notes and reliability reports for more information.
